NAME
mpt_get_cb_idx - obtain cb_idx for registered driver
SYNOPSIS
u8 mpt_get_cb_idx(MPT_DRIVER_CLASS dclass);
ARGUMENTS
dclass class driver enum
DESCRIPTION
Returns cb_idx, or zero means it wasn't found
